|
| Titre : | Porsuite d'une cible mobile à l'aide d'un réseaux de capteur | | Type de document : | theses et memoires | | Auteurs : | Tarik Bouheraoua ; Kenoui Mohamed ; Mustapha Lalam, Directeur de thèse | | Editeur : | Tizi Ouzou : UMMTO.FGEI | | Année de publication : | 2010 | | Importance : | 63p.0 | | Présentation : | ill. | | Format : | 28cm | | Note générale : | Bibliogr. | | Langues : | Français | | Mots-clés : | Réseaux | | Résumé : | Les réseaux de capteurs sans fil vont sans doute dans les dix années à venir constituer un
développement technologique majeur apportant des solutions aux différents problèmes
sociaux liés à la santé, la sécurité, les transports, l'automatisation des bâtiments, etc. De
nombreux pays sont déjà entrés dans l'ère de ces réseaux ubiquitaires et à la fois universités
et industries sont très actives dans le domaine. Il n'existe pas vraiment aujourd'hui
d'application phare ("killer application").
Cependant certaines pourraient bien émerger, conséquence de réglementations dans les
transports ou les bâtiments, par exemple. Un des verrous majeurs pour la large diffusion de
ces réseaux de capteurs est celui de l'autonomie en énergie qui nécessite encore beaucoup de
travaux de recherche.
La réalisation de ce projet nécessite le choix d'un système d'exploitation, d'un émulateur de
capteurs et d'un langage de programmation permettant d'implémenter des applications sur
ces mêmes capteurs. Pour cela notre tuteur nous a proposée de travailler avec les system
d’exploitation TinyOS qui est dédié pour les réseaux de capteurs. Pour le développement des
applications ont utilise le langage de programmation NesC qui est capable d’interagir avec
TinyOS, Ce langage dédié est proche du langage C mais il est oriente composants.
Au cours de notre projet, nous avons dans un premier temps, commencé par introduire les
réseaux sans fils, ensuite nous avons présenté les réseaux de capteurs sans fils et leur mode
de positionnement et localisation, et enfin nous avons étudié le système d’exploitation
TinyOs et son langage de programmation le NesC.
Si le sujet, au début, ne parait pas très compliqué, la réalisation pratique l’a été beaucoup
plus et pas seulement parce qu’il s’est agit de programmation embarquée. En effet, les outils
sont dispersés et pas tous fonctionnels immédiatement. Ces simulateurs ne sont de plus opérationnels qu’après des manipulations pas évidentes Ã
trouver.
Nous avons simulé la compilation de l’application BLINK qui change l’état des diodes sur un
capteur, le résultat était satisfaisant. | | En ligne : | D:\CD.THESE.INF\CD.LIC.INF.2010\BOUHERAOUA.TARIK-KENOUI.MOHAMED.PDF | | Format de la ressource électronique : | PDF | | Permalink : | ./index.php?lvl=notice_display&id=31434 |
Porsuite d'une cible mobile à l'aide d'un réseaux de capteur [theses et memoires] / Tarik Bouheraoua ; Kenoui Mohamed ; Mustapha Lalam, Directeur de thèse . - Tizi Ouzou (Tizi Ouzou) : UMMTO.FGEI, 2010 . - 63p.0 : ill. ; 28cm. Bibliogr. Langues : Français | Mots-clés : | Réseaux | | Résumé : | Les réseaux de capteurs sans fil vont sans doute dans les dix années à venir constituer un
développement technologique majeur apportant des solutions aux différents problèmes
sociaux liés à la santé, la sécurité, les transports, l'automatisation des bâtiments, etc. De
nombreux pays sont déjà entrés dans l'ère de ces réseaux ubiquitaires et à la fois universités
et industries sont très actives dans le domaine. Il n'existe pas vraiment aujourd'hui
d'application phare ("killer application").
Cependant certaines pourraient bien émerger, conséquence de réglementations dans les
transports ou les bâtiments, par exemple. Un des verrous majeurs pour la large diffusion de
ces réseaux de capteurs est celui de l'autonomie en énergie qui nécessite encore beaucoup de
travaux de recherche.
La réalisation de ce projet nécessite le choix d'un système d'exploitation, d'un émulateur de
capteurs et d'un langage de programmation permettant d'implémenter des applications sur
ces mêmes capteurs. Pour cela notre tuteur nous a proposée de travailler avec les system
d’exploitation TinyOS qui est dédié pour les réseaux de capteurs. Pour le développement des
applications ont utilise le langage de programmation NesC qui est capable d’interagir avec
TinyOS, Ce langage dédié est proche du langage C mais il est oriente composants.
Au cours de notre projet, nous avons dans un premier temps, commencé par introduire les
réseaux sans fils, ensuite nous avons présenté les réseaux de capteurs sans fils et leur mode
de positionnement et localisation, et enfin nous avons étudié le système d’exploitation
TinyOs et son langage de programmation le NesC.
Si le sujet, au début, ne parait pas très compliqué, la réalisation pratique l’a été beaucoup
plus et pas seulement parce qu’il s’est agit de programmation embarquée. En effet, les outils
sont dispersés et pas tous fonctionnels immédiatement. Ces simulateurs ne sont de plus opérationnels qu’après des manipulations pas évidentes Ã
trouver.
Nous avons simulé la compilation de l’application BLINK qui change l’état des diodes sur un
capteur, le résultat était satisfaisant. | | En ligne : | D:\CD.THESE.INF\CD.LIC.INF.2010\BOUHERAOUA.TARIK-KENOUI.MOHAMED.PDF | | Format de la ressource électronique : | PDF | | Permalink : | ./index.php?lvl=notice_display&id=31434 |
|